I stayed 4 nights as part of a National Coach Holiday trip, with Bed Breakfast and Evening meal included in the package. The location of the hotel and the communal areas cannot be faulted, and all areas were very clean. The staff were helpful and friendly. The big disappointment was being told that we could not get our evening meal until 7.30pm. We had to pre book from a 3 course menu on arrival and subsequently each evening. 7.30 pm was late for a lot of us, being of a mature age! Also service was badly planned as the waiting staff came out and went round the room asking who was having which dish. This not only took a lot of time and also some people forgot what they had pre -ordered. With 3 courses to serve we did not finish until 9pm. This is not the waiting staff's fault, but bad management practice. However on the fourth night, all was chaos. two more coach parties had been booked in and there was mayhem, and a near riot in the dining room with about 160 people trying to get seated. it was after 8pm before service started, again not the fault of the staff. A lady on our table did not get her starter at all. I think she was quite relieved as Bruschetta does not consist of a lump of soggy brown bread, a roughly chopped tomato, some thick slices of onion, and the half dead and wilted salad greens which were served with most meals. No apology from the management. Breakfast was excellent. The rooms were a good size and were clean, but the bathroom was shabby, chipped bath and basin and a toilet seat that was not very secure. The beverage station did not get replenished until Thursday, and the dirty mugs did not get replaced throughout our stay. The. basin tap broke on Thursday morning, which I reported, but it did not get fixed. Can't fault the staff, but working practice and management leave a lot to be desired. Thank goodness for my fellow travellers, whose friendship and brilliant sense of humour made it all worthwhile. Also thanks to National Coach Holidays and our driver.FromSGD 83

Had a lovely stay but felt let down by several issues. Check in was nice & smooth with friendly staff. We had upgraded our room to a superior & it was lovely & clean but had very little storage, especially the bathroom. This wouldn’t have been a problem for 1 night but we stayed 4. The views from the floor to ceiling window were superb. Room servicing appears to have been stopped throughout the country now since covid & if that is to continue then I would suggest larger bins are provided. Surely over a 4 night stay it is not unreasonable to have the room serviced at least once. Our “king size” bed was in fact 2 singles pushed together with the ever present gap in the middle. The toilet paper was cheap & nasty & out of keeping with the rest of the hotel. Breakfast was buffet style, adequate & reasonable. The drinks menu said there was a “guest ale” & to enquire at the bar to see what is was & the price. When I asked what the “guest ale” was I was told it was CIDER. Location is no more than a 5 minutes walk from the railway station. Overall we had a vey enjoyable stay & would definitely stop again.FromSGD 71
